Get startedRyecroft Farm is an end-of-terrace house in Harden, Bingley, Bingley (BD16 1DH). It has a recorded floor area of 277 m² (around 2982 sq ft), construction records dating it to before 1900 and council tax band G. The latest certificate (June 2018) shows an E (score 44), well below the UK norm with real room to improve. The recommended improvements would lift it to C (score 69), a 2-band jump.
At 277 m² the property is well over the postcode median (177 m² across 12 EPCs), placing it in the larger end of the local stock. It lags the bulk of the postcode on energy efficiency (less efficient than 75% of similar EPCs). 7 planning records sit against the property, 5 approved, 1 refused. Past consents include new windows, meaningful when judging how the property has evolved. Today's modelled estimate of £673,000 is 49.6% above the 2019 sale price.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£151/sq ft) was about 34.8% below the postcode norm. Sold February 2019 for £450,000.
